General part information

NCP1339 Series

The NCP1339 is a highly integrated quasi-resonant flyback controller capable of controlling rugged and high-performance off-line power supplies as required by adapter applications. With an integrated active X-cap discharge feature and power savings mode, the NCP1339 can enable no-load power consumption below 10 mW for 65 W notebook adapters.The quasi-resonant current-mode flyback stage features a proprietary valley-lockout circuitry, ensuring stable valley switching. This system works down to the 6th valley and toggles to a frequency foldback mode to eliminate switching losses. When the loop tends to force below 25-kHz frequencies, the NCP1339 skips cycles to contain the power delivery.To help build rugged converters, the controller features several key protective features: an internal brown-out, a non-dissipative Over Power Protection for a constant maximum output current regardless of the input voltage, a latched over voltage protection through a dedicated pin.
